A great chance to practice. For graduates of Start Sailing Right (or sailors with similar experience) who would like to get some “stick time” under the supervision of a US Sailing certified ASF Instructor. On four Saturdays you’ll be at the tiller of a Sunfish or similar boat, practicing tacks and jibes in a variety of wind conditions that TTL serves up. Price: $195. Saturday afternoons 1-5. You’ll need to provide your own PFD (type III “life jacket”) and you’ll need to demonstrate that you can swim 50 yards in sailing clothes.
